So, you're saying that clicking 'Build Audiobook' doesn't begin the build process that generates a new file? Builds are working as expected to here in our tests and we haven't received reports from other users that aren't able to build, so the issue may be unique to your Mac. Would you be willing to reproduce the issue and then generate a System Information report to send over to us? This report may provide an explanation. You can create one of these reports by clicking the Finder icon in your Dock, going to the Go menu at the top of your screen, clicking the Utilities menu item, opening System Information.app, then going to the File menu and clicking the Save... menu item. Attach the resulting file to an email to us at support@splasm.com and we'll have a look.
